>I have problems when I try to isolate total RNA from mouse liver or brain by
>Chomczynsky method, because the two phases I should obtain after adding
>phenol and chloroform doesn't separate during centrifugation. This
>difficults the extraction and makes the efficiency to be very low.Does
>anybody know why this happens and how to avoid? Is this method good enough
>to extract RNA from those tissues?

Hi,
I think there is too much lipids in the liver and perhaps you put too much
liver for your extraction. We use only 1 mg of liver for 5 ml of extraction
buffer and we make 2 phenol/chloroform because of lipids
